Output 33a3341d05c80cda8354839eda24ae8800a92f7e86fbbe3309f6ccffb82c625f:0

value
51084196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454e5dd15fbfe085da05e47e8910bb4d1d6c6b44 OP_EQUAL
address
381URn6LbuBcbPu8xW27MTtDfLWacim6eQ
transaction
33a3341d05c80cda8354839eda24ae8800a92f7e86fbbe3309f6ccffb82c625f
confirmations
372404
spent
true